Members of the 185th Air Refueling Wing took part in the Iowa National Guard's Governor's X marksmanship competition at Camp Dodge near Des Moines Iowa, on May 22, 2016. Iowa Army National Guard and Iowa Air National Guard members got a chance to display their skills with various firearms in team events and individual challenges during the event, which has been happening annually since 1975.

After the 185th held tryouts, the wing sent three teams to the competition, each consisting of four Airmen. Teams from the 185th took first and second place in the total combined score of the event. All three teams finished in the top eight out of 23 total teams.

Tech. Sgt. Micah Larson assigned to the 185th ARW Security Forces Squadron, took second place in the individual combine score and Tech. Sgt. Mike Simoni, also assigned to the 185th Security Forces Squadron took third place. Out of the 97 competitors the 185th had four members finish in the top ten in individual competitions. Airmen from the unit also finished first in the team machine gun competition.

According to Master Sgt. Anthony Jensen with the security forces squadron, 185th members shot using the M16A2 rifle, M-9 pistol and the M249 light machine gun. One challenge involved members running 300 yards and then firing at a target.

The top 10 members receive the Governor's X tab to wear on their uniforms and this also gives them a chance to compete with other Guard members at regional and national events. 

Major Brandon East, the 185th Security Forces Squadron commander, said that the competitions are very challenging, especially at the national level.

"We're looking for the best sharp shooter, the best of the best from the unit, we go down there to win and the folks you're competing against are not slouches," said East.

According to East, the competition wasn't for those looking to improve their skills rather it was for more experienced shooters.
